📍 Strategies for Local Businesses

If you own a local business and want to attract more foot traffic, creating a GBT can be an effective strategy. Here are some steps you can follow:

  • Understanding Search Engines: Before creating a GBT, it's essential to understand how search engines work. By analyzing search queries and organizing information, search engines provide users with the most relevant results.
  • Creating a GBT with a Local Focus: When creating a localized GBT, avoid using the term "GBT" in the name, as it is discouraged by the OpenAI policy. Instead, create a simple name by combining your business name with the local location, such as "Business Name - San Francisco."
  • Optimizing the GBT Name and Description: Optimize the name and description of your GBT by including relevant keywords and phrases that describe your business. Focus on providing specific information about your business's offerings, such as products, services, and location.
  • Adding Relevant Information and Address: Make sure to include pertinent details like address, operating hours, contact number, and a concise description of your business. This information will help users find your business easily when using the GBT.

🌐 Creating a GBT for Web Cafe Software

If you have an online marketplace like Web Cafe software, creating a specialized GBT can provide a competitive advantage. Here's how you can proceed:

  • Introduction to Web Cafe Software: Web Cafe software is a marketplace that offers pre-built AI automations at a lower cost than traditional automation engineering services. By creating a GBT for the software, you can assist users in finding the best AI solutions for their specific needs.
  • Building a GBT for the Marketplace: Start by creating a GBT profile for Web Cafe software. Upload the relevant information, including the logo and a summary of what the marketplace offers. This will allow users to discover the software easily through the GBT store.
  • Uploading Product Catalog using CSV: If you have a product catalog for Web Cafe software, export it as a CSV file. Upload this file to the GBT's Knowledge Base, enabling users to search for specific products and providing them with relevant information.
  • Testing the GBT with Preset Questions: Use preset questions to test the effectiveness of your GBT. Ensure that it provides accurate and valuable information, including product names, descriptions, and links.
  • Improving Instructions and Formatting: Continuously improve the GBT's instructions and formatting. Fine-tune the responses and provide additional context to enhance the user experience.
